JAMSHEDPUR – A recently inaugurated park, funded by MLA resources in front of the Jamshedpur District Bar Association, was demolished, leading to significant unrest among local lawyers.

The park, opened two months ago by MLA Saryu Rai, was vandalized on a court holiday, catching the legal community off-guard the following day.

Upon noticing the demolition, advocates expressed profound displeasure, prompting a delegation to seek intervention from the Chief Justice of Jamshedpur Court.

The Chief Justice, alongside the Registrar and other officials, assessed the situation and committed to reconstructing the park, which temporarily alleviated tensions.

Plans have been revealed to replace the park with an e-court compound, despite prior assurances to the advocates that existing structures would be preserved to accommodate court visitors and legal professionals.

The legal community highlighted the lack of parking and adequate facilities within the court premises, underscoring the need for better infrastructure to support both lawyers and their clients.
